Are cd mixes recorded from a DJ mixing with vinyl, or using a cdj? I am assuming a cdj, but I want to know for sure, lol.

Hey warped_candykid

You can do both, depends on what the dj likes. If he likes vinyl, he can do it with them, but today many dj's prefer cd's because they are smaller and easier to get.

Some dj mixes are also done without cd's or vinyl, just with computer dj programs or special kind of hardware that gives you the opportunity to mix with mp3/wav files.

And at least, you can also mix with tapes that would be massive 0ldschool

Most of the new comps don't use either and are just done on a computer...
Not even really mixed at all.

Bonkers 1 was on decks and I guess lots of the older mixes would have been too.
